Understanding Commission Structures: What’s Best for You?

In affiliate marketing, especially in the cryptocurrency niche, choosing the right commission model can significantly impact your earnings. The most common structures include CPA (Cost Per Action), CPS (Cost Per Sale), and RevShare (Revenue Share). Each has its own set of advantages and challenges, making it essential to understand what suits your audience and business model best. Let's dive into each structure and examine how they work in the crypto space.

Different affiliate programs offer varying commission types. Some reward affiliates based on the number of users they bring to the platform, while others pay according to the value of the transactions those users complete. Understanding which model fits your marketing strategy and audience behavior is crucial. Below, we break down some key commission structures used in the crypto world.

Common Affiliate Commission Models in Crypto

  • CPA (Cost Per Action): You earn a fixed amount when a referred user completes a specific action, like signing up or completing a KYC process.
  • CPS (Cost Per Sale): You earn a commission based on a user making a purchase, such as trading or buying cryptocurrency on an exchange.
  • RevShare (Revenue Share): You receive a percentage of the revenue generated by your referrals over time, usually from their trades or fees.

How to Choose the Right Structure for Your Campaign

Understanding the strengths of each commission type is key to selecting the most effective structure for your affiliate marketing campaign. Here’s a breakdown of the benefits of each model in the crypto space:

  1. CPA is ideal if you want quick, one-time payouts for each new lead or sign-up. It’s a great choice if your goal is to generate mass traffic with minimal effort on conversions.
  2. CPS works well if your audience is more likely to make transactions or purchases, and you want to earn based on the value of those actions.
  3. RevShare provides the potential for recurring income over time, which can be highly profitable if your referrals are active traders or investors.

Important: RevShare models in crypto can be highly rewarding for affiliates with a dedicated following, but they often require long-term effort to see substantial returns.

Quick Comparison of Commission Models

Model Commission Type Best For
CPA Fixed payment per lead or action Quick payouts with minimal user actions required
CPS Percentage of sale value Affiliates targeting users who make purchases
RevShare Percentage of revenue over time Affiliates looking for recurring income

Tracking Methods and Tools for Crypto Affiliate Sales

To effectively track your affiliate sales and performance, you’ll need to combine traditional tracking methods with crypto-specific tools. Here’s a breakdown:

  • Affiliate Program Dashboard: Most cryptocurrency platforms offer built-in tracking tools to monitor clicks, sign-ups, and purchases. These dashboards can show detailed information about the affiliate’s performance.
  • UTM Parameters: UTM codes help track the source of traffic, campaigns, and content types. By using UTM parameters in your affiliate links, you can monitor which specific ads or posts are driving conversions.
  • Blockchain Analytics: Some crypto affiliate platforms use blockchain technology to track transactions, providing an additional layer of transparency and accuracy.
  • Third-Party Tracking Tools: Platforms like Bit.ly or Google Analytics can also track clicks, though they may not always capture transactions on the blockchain.

How to Analyze Affiliate Performance in Crypto Marketing

Once you’ve set up your tracking, it’s time to analyze the data. Understanding which strategies work best for driving affiliate sales will allow you to focus your efforts on the most profitable channels. Key metrics to monitor include:

  1. Conversion Rate: The percentage of visitors who complete a desired action (such as making a purchase or signing up) after clicking on your affiliate link.
  2. Click-Through Rate (CTR): This shows how often people click on your affiliate link compared to how many times it’s viewed.
  3. Revenue Per Click (RPC): Calculate how much you earn per click to determine which campaigns or platforms are most profitable.
  4. Return on Investment (ROI): Measure how much you earn versus how much you spend on advertising or other promotional efforts.

Tip: Always compare your results across different campaigns and traffic sources to identify patterns. This will help you refine your strategy and focus on high-performing channels.

How to Stay Compliant with Affiliate Marketing Regulations

Affiliate marketing in the cryptocurrency sector requires marketers to adhere to a set of legal standards, ensuring transparency and trustworthiness. As digital assets grow in popularity, authorities have implemented stricter guidelines to protect consumers and prevent fraud. Marketers must stay informed about these regulations to avoid legal issues while promoting cryptocurrency-related services and products.

Compliance with affiliate marketing regulations is crucial for both affiliates and the businesses they promote. Failure to meet these standards could lead to penalties, fines, or even the termination of affiliate partnerships. The following guidelines can help affiliates stay compliant while promoting cryptocurrency-related products.

Key Guidelines for Affiliate Marketers in the Cryptocurrency Industry

  • Disclosure of Relationships: Affiliates must clearly disclose their affiliate relationships with cryptocurrency platforms or services. This helps maintain transparency and trust with the audience.
  • Accurate Advertising: All claims about cryptocurrency products or services must be accurate and truthful. Avoid misleading or exaggerated statements to prevent false advertising violations.
  • Data Protection: Be mindful of consumer privacy and data protection regulations such as GDPR. Affiliates must not engage in practices that compromise user information.
  • Adherence to Local Laws: Different countries have different rules regarding the promotion of financial products like cryptocurrencies. Affiliates should understand and follow the laws that apply in their target markets.

Common Compliance Violations to Avoid

  1. Promoting unregistered or illegal cryptocurrency schemes
  2. Failing to disclose affiliate links or sponsored content
  3. Making false or misleading claims about potential earnings or risks

Important: Always review local regulations regularly, as cryptocurrency laws evolve rapidly. Stay updated on changes that could impact your affiliate marketing activities.
